Studio-A-Rama is WRUW’s annual FREE, outdoor, day-long rock concert, and it’s a great opportunity for local and regional bands to showcase their talent and have their music heard. WRUW is proud to simulcast Studio-A-Rama over its 15,000 watts air signal, as well as on the internet at www.wruw.org and WRUW’s own YouTube channel www.youtube.com/wruwfm.

Since 1982, WRUW has staged this free annual concert designed to thank listeners for their ongoing support throughout the year, and especially during WRUW’s annual telethon. An enthusiastic audience response during the annual on-air fundraiser enables WRUW to continue hosting Studio-A-Rama as well as fund live webcasting and support local music and live music. Studio-A-Rama is one part of WRUW-FM’s commitment to broadcasting local bands live. The “Live From Cleveland” show broadcasts bands from the WRUW-FM studios every Thursday evening from 10 until 11pm, and WRUW also simulcasts numerous live music from events such as the Cleveland Museum of Art’s Summer Solstice, the Hessler Street Fair, Dyngus Day, and WRUW’s annual “Live From Lakewood”.
